Cleansing
The first
step in any skincare routine is cleansing. Cleansing helps remove dirt, oil,
makeup, and other impurities that have accumulated on your skin throughout the
day. It's crucial to choose a gentle cleanser that suits your skin type.
Whether you have oily, dry, or combination skin, there are cleansers
specifically formulated for each type.
Massage the
cleanser onto damp skin using circular motions, focusing on areas prone to
oiliness or congestion, such as the T-zone. Rinse thoroughly with lukewarm
water and pat your face dry with a clean towel. Cleansing your skin prepares it
for the subsequent steps of your skincare routine.
Toning
After
cleansing, it's time to tone your skin. Toners help balance your skin's pH
levels, remove any remaining traces of dirt or impurities, and prepare your
skin for better absorption of the products that follow. Look for toners that
are alcohol-free and contain h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id or
soothing ingredients like rose water.
Apply the
toner to a cotton pad and gently swipe it across your face, avoiding the
delicate eye area. You can also pat the toner directly onto your skin with
clean hands. Allow the toner to fully absorb before moving on to the next step.
Essence and Serums
Next in your
skincare routine are essences and serums. These lightweight, highly
concentrated products deliver active ingredients deep into your skin, targeting
specific concerns such as hydration, brightening, or acne. Essences are usually
more watery in consistency, while serums have a slightly thicker texture.
Take a few
drops of essence or serum onto your fingertips and gently press or pat them
into your skin. This tapping motion helps promote absorption and stimulates
blood circulation, giving your skin a healthy glow. Allow the essence or serum
to fully absorb before proceeding.
Moisturizing
Keeping your
skin well-hydrated is vital for achieving glass skin. Moisturizers create a
protective barrier on your skin, sealing in moisture and preventing water loss.
It's crucial to choose a moisturizer that suits your skin type and addresses
any specific concerns you may have.
Take a
pea-sized amount of moisturizer and apply it to your face and neck, gently
massaging it in using upward motions. Don't forget to extend the moisturizer
down to your décolletage to ensure your skin is fully hydrated. Allow the
moisturizer to fully absorb before moving on to the next step.
Eye Cream
The delicate
skin around your eyes requires special care. Eye creams help hydrate, firm, and
reduce the appearance of fine lines and dark circles. When applying eye cream,
use your ring finger as it exerts the least amount of pressure, avoiding any
unnecessary tugging or pulling of the delicate skin.
Dab a small
amount of eye cream onto your ring finger and gently pat it around your eye
area, starting from the outer corner and working your way inward. Be gentle and
avoid applying too close to your lash line. Allow the eye cream to absorb
before proceeding.
Sunscreen
Protecting
your skin from harmful UV rays is crucial to maintaining its health and
preventing premature aging. Sunscreen should be the final step in your skincare
routine, regardless of whether you're heading outdoors or staying indoors. Look
for a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her.
Take a
sufficient amount of sunscreen and apply it evenly to your face and neck,
making sure to cover all exposed areas. Don't forget to extend it down to your
décolletage as well. Reapply sunscreen every two hours, especially if you're
spending an extended amount of time outdoors.
Korean Skincare Routine
The glass
skin trend initially gained popularity in South Korea, where skincare is not
just a routine but a cultural phenomenon. Korean skincare focuses on achieving
healthy, radiant skin through a multi-step routine that includes cleansing,
toning, treating, moisturizing, and protecting.
One unique
aspect of the Korean skincare routine is the use of multiple thinly-applied
layers of hydrating products, such as essences and ampoules. This practice
helps lock in moisture and ensure maximum absorption of active ingredients.
In addition
to the basic steps mentioned earlier, the Korean skincare routine often
includes additional treatments like sheet masks, exfoliators, and sleeping
packs. These treatments are used to address specific concerns and give your
skin an extra boost of hydration or nourishment.
